The State’s Attorney’s Office prosecutes all felony, misdemeanor and traffic offenses in Piatt County. The State’s Attorney’s Office initiates all dependency, neglect, abuse and delinquency juvenile petitions and proceedings. The State’s Attorney also advises and represents the County Board and Piatt County officers. The State’s Attorney’s Office cannot file lawsuits on behalf of individuals or advise the public on the law.
